Looks OK, but then again, a 3500 km OCI isn't exactly a stretch for any lube, so the low numbers are to be expected.

Consider extending the OCIs out; you're wasting a lot of money dumping perfectly good oil this early. You can easily double (probably triple) your OCI next time. The whole point of UOAs is to judge the direct health of the lubricant, and indirectly infer the health of the engine. The goal is to maximize the useful life of the oil, so don't be afraid to push the OCIs out. Plenty of evidence exists to show this engine and lube can safely go much further.
